The song I have chosen is 



He's Alive



Although I first learned this song as part of adult worship I love to do this with the kids groups as they always enjoy clapping to the beat and they need to know that 
Jesus is ALIVE!


My husband is a worship leader but also accompanies the children a lot on the guitar and he will go up the keys while playing this with the kids just as he would in church worship time.






My original visual for this was made many years ago and was a large piece of pink card see below.






This original visual was hand written on A1 card and then covered in clear sticky plastic to help protect it and it did a good job because that visual can still be used today if necessary.


Then more recently I redesigned it on Powerpoint to be projected and also to be printed out on A4 cards

Notes:
I have found some versions of a song with this as a chorus except the words are very slightly different and we have always sung it to a different tempo as well.
I have also found the chorus part on it's own attributed to

Shawn Craig

1985 Above And Beyond Music

CCLI Song # 98767

The song I have chosen is 




WHO MADE?


My own children enjoyed singing this as they grew up through our Good News Club and Sunday School.

It is a simple repetitive song which strongly teaches the children that God is the creator of all things and of course there are some great actions for everyone to take part.

ACTIONS

Who made the twinkling stars  -  Hold up hands  at head height & Tap fingers and thumb together on both hands 

Who made the fish that swim  -  Place two hands palms together pointing forward and wiggle them

Who made the flowers & the trees  -  Close hands and bring them together in front and then open the hands to represent flowers opening

Who made the rolling waves  -  Place arms in front of you with one hand a few inches in front of the other and then circle the hands round each other in a rolling motion

Who made both you and me  -  Point outwards for you and in toward yourself for me

Our Father God  -  Simply point and look upwards.

Notes:

The words and music for this are noted as traditional see here
and I cannot find any author.

I believe I probably made up the verse about the flowers and the trees but not sure.

If anyone has any further info on this song please let me know.
